Flowers From Heaven
- Address
- 1023 S Ventura Blvd
- Place
- Oxnard , CA 93030
Description
Flowers From Heaven can be found at 1023 S Ventura Blvd . The following is offered: Event Planners, Wedding Planners, Florists, Gifts, Gift Baskets, Artificial Plants & Flowers - In Oxnard there are 14 other Event Planners. An overview can be found here.
Reviews
This listing was not reviewed yet